1. What Are Fertility Testing Antibody Pairs?

Fertility testing antibody pairs are matched sets of capture and detection monoclonal antibodies used in sandwich immunoassays to quantify reproductive hormones and fertility biomarkers in serum, plasma or whole blood. They are the core raw material components in chemiluminescent immunoassay (CLIA), fluorescence immunoassay (FIA), ELISA and lateral flow assay (LFA) platforms used in IVF clinics, fertility centers, hospitals and home testing devices.

Reproductive hormone quantification is among the most clinically sensitive areas in IVD — small measurement errors in AMH, FSH or LH can directly affect treatment decisions such as ovarian stimulation protocols, IVF cycle planning and PCOS diagnosis. This makes antibody pair performance — sensitivity, specificity, cross-reactivity, and lot-to-lot consistency — especially critical for fertility assay manufacturers.

The primary fertility biomarkers in the clinical IVD market include:

  • Ovarian reserve: Anti-Müllerian Hormone (AMH) — cycle-independent, stable marker for follicular pool assessment
  • Ovulation and pituitary function: Luteinizing Hormone (LH) and Follicle-Stimulating Hormone (FSH) — the hormonal drivers of the ovarian cycle
  • Pregnancy detection: human Chorionic Gonadotropin (hCG) — the definitive marker for early pregnancy and trophoblastic disease
  • Sex hormone status: Estradiol (E2), Progesterone — ovarian activity, luteal phase support and IVF monitoring
  • Androgen assessment: Testosterone — PCOS workup, male hypogonadism and androgen excess disorders
  • Male fertility: SP10 (Acrosin-Binding Protein) — sperm function marker for point-of-care male fertility rapid tests

Why is AMH the preferred marker for ovarian reserve testing?

AMH is produced directly by granulosa cells in small antral follicles and remains stable throughout the menstrual cycle — unlike FSH and E2, which fluctuate significantly with cycle phase. This means AMH can be measured on any cycle day, making it more convenient and reproducible for ovarian reserve assessment. What is SP10 and how is it used in male fertility IVD?

SP10 (Acrosin-Binding Protein, ACRBP) is a sperm-specific marker expressed on the acrosome of mature spermatozoa. Its concentration in seminal plasma correlates with sperm motility and acrosome integrity — providing a functional male fertility measure beyond total sperm count. How does Sekbio control cross-reactivity between structurally similar reproductive hormones?

LH, FSH, hCG and TSH all share a common alpha subunit, creating a risk of cross-reactivity in immunoassays. Sekbio selects antibody clones that target unique beta-subunit epitopes and screens every pair against the full panel of structurally related hormones before catalog listing.
